Koppány, also called Cupan was a Hungarian lord in the late 10th century and leader of pagans opposing the Christianization of Hungary. As the duke of Somogy, he laid claim to the throne based on the traditional idea of seniority, but was defeated and executed by Stephen (born with the pagan name Vajk), son of the previous grand prince Géza.
